Abstract
Capacity building in pedagogical research methods is positioned by researchers as crucial to global  competitiveness.  The  pedagogies  involved,  however,  remain  under-researched  and  the  peda-gogical  culture  under-developed.  This  paper  builds  upon  recent  thematic  reviews  of  the  literature  to  report new research that shifts the focus  individual experiences of research methods teaching to empirical evidence  a study crossing research methods, disciplines and nations. A dialogic, expert panel  method  was  used,  engaging  international  experts  to  examine  teaching  and  learning  practices  in  advanced social research methods. Experts, perspectives demonstrated strong thematic commonalities across  quantitative,  qualitative  and  mixed  methods  domains  in  terms  of  pedagogy,  by  connecting  learners  to  research,  giving  direct  and  immersive  experiences  of  research  practice  and  promoting  reflexivity. This paper argues that through analysis of expert responses to the distinct pedagogic chal-lenges  of  the  methods  classroom,  the  principles  and  illustrative  examples  generated  can  form  the  knowledge and understanding required to enhance pedagogic culture and practice.
